The hotel is just 5 minutes from the airport and provides a free shuttle service. Mr. Huu is such a nice guy; he speaks simple English and explained everything clearly to us. The hotel offers motorcycle rentals, but we rented ours from Mr. Phu (+84909 296 989) for VND 150,000 per day. VinBus No. 19 is a free bus provided by the Vin group but doesn't stop at this hotel, the nearest stop is at Sunset Sunato station, which is 1.5 km from the hotel. The hotel provides a shuttle to town daily at 10 am and 2 pm, with returns to the hotel at 10:30 am, 2:30 pm, and 5 pm. Alternatively, you can download the Xanh SM app to call for a taxi, but you need a Vietnam SIM card to register.
We booked a pool access room, which is very spacious, and the pool is so long we had a great time here. You can always call a buggy car to pick you up from your villa to the restaurant; otherwise, it's an easy 5-minute walk to the restaurant/seaside.
The only complaint is the gym equipment, which is quite dated. One treadmill is broken, and I found lizard droppings on the treadmill; proper cleaning would be much appreciated. Last but not least, if you leave a review on Google, you can claim a buy-one-get-one-free drink at the restaurant.
